For those about to rock, we assume you!
Or something like that, because two of the ’70s most iconic rock outfits will be resurrected by two amazing national cover acts. Break out your leather and grimy white tees for the AC/DC and Rush Tribute Show, going down this Friday at Churchill’s Pub (5501 NE Second Ave., Miami).
Shot Down in Flames from Northeast Florida will bring the “T.N.T.,” playing all the AC/DC classics and making sure all dirty deeds are done dirt cheap. On the flip side, the fellow Floridians of Crush will step into the “Limelight,” bringing the “Spirit of the Radio” to life like the modern “Tom Sawyer”s they are.
These bands go all out, from clothes to antics to attitude and, of course, pure skill. If you were too young to catch Geddy Lee or Brian Johnson in their heyday, this is the best way to get your kicks and shake it all night long.
Fri., May 3, 8 p.m., 2013
